Com utilitzar la funció PHP str_split().

Com Utilitzar La Funcio Php Str Split



La funció PHP str_split() pot ser útil per realitzar operacions sobre caràcters individuals d'una cadena, com ara manipulació, comparació i cerca. Aquesta funció pot dividir una cadena en una matriu de caràcters i en aquest article parlarem de com utilitzar la funció str_split() en PHP, juntament amb alguns exemples per demostrar-ne l'ús.

Utilitzant la funció PHP str_split().

La cadena que s'ha de dividir i el nombre de caràcters per element de matriu són les dues entrades per a la funció str split(). Si no s'especifica el segon paràmetre, la funció divideix la cadena en caràcters individuals, la sintaxi de la funció str_split() és la següent:

str_dividir ( $cadena , $split_length ) ;

On $cadena és la cadena d'entrada que s'ha de dividir i $split_length és la longitud de cada element de la matriu. Si no es proporciona el paràmetre $split_length, la funció divideix la cadena en caràcters individuals.







Exemple 1: dividir una cadena en caràcters individuals

En aquest exemple, utilitzarem la funció str_split() per dividir una cadena en caràcters individuals i mostrar el resultat a la pantalla:





$cadena = 'Hola, Linux' ;

$caracters = str_dividir ( $cadena ) ;

print_r ( $caracters ) ;

?>

En aquest codi, primer definim una variable de cadena que conté el text 'Hola, Linux'. Aleshores cridem a la funció str_split() amb la variable $string com a primer paràmetre. La funció divideix la cadena en caràcters individuals i retorna una matriu que conté els caràcters. La funció print_r() per mostrar la matriu resultant a la pantalla:







Exemple 2: Divisió d'una cadena en subcadenes de longitud fixa

En aquest exemple, utilitzarem la funció str_split() per dividir una cadena en subcadenes de longitud fixa de dos caràcters cadascuna.



$cadena = 'Hola Linux' ;

$subcadenes = str_dividir ( $cadena , 2 ) ;

print_r ( $subcadenes ) ;

?>

En aquest codi, primer definim una variable de cadena que conté tota la cadena. A continuació, cridem a la funció str_split() amb la variable $string com a primer paràmetre i el valor 2 com a segon paràmetre. La funció divideix el text en subcadenes de dos caràcters i genera una matriu de subcadenes. A continuació, utilitzem la funció print_r() per mostrar la matriu resultant a la pantalla.



 Interfície d'usuari gràfica, text, descripció de l'aplicació generada automàticament

Conclusió

La funció PHP str_split() és una eina útil per dividir cadenes en caràcters individuals o subcadenes de longitud fixa. En entendre com utilitzar la funció str_split(), els desenvolupadors poden realitzar diverses operacions sobre caràcters individuals o subcadenes d'una cadena. La funció str_split() és fàcil d'utilitzar i versàtil, la qual cosa la converteix en una funció valuosa per a qualsevol desenvolupador de PHP.